A magnetic ballast (also called a choke) contains a coil of copper wire. The magnetic field produced by the wire traps most of the current so only the right amount gets through to the fluorescent light. An ANSI ballast for standard 40-watt F40T12 lamps requires a ballast factor of 0.95; the same ballast has a ballast factor of 0.87 for 34-watt energy saving F40T12 lamps. However, many ballasts are available with either high (conforming to the ANSI specifications) or low ballast factors (70 to 75%).

An improved reactor and ballast system is provided. The reactor includes a core having an I portion and a rolled portion which forms a core opening, a coil having an electrically insulated coil opening through which the I portion extends, and a spacer between the I portion and an edge of the rolled portion of the core. A portion of the coil extends into the core opening.

Aug 10, 2014· Water or fixed ballast? Scamp is designed to take on approximately 175 lb. of water as ballast. I never felt quite right about this design characteristic. Though I appreciate the concept of water ballast in larger sailboats (where weight savings can be over 1,000 lb.) I question whether the benefits are realized in small sailing.

Input Voltage. Input voltage is the amount of AC voltage the ballast can accept. This value may be a range, such as 120 to 277VAC, or it may be a fixed value, such as 120VAC.

What is Hematite? Hematite is one of the most abundant minerals on Earth's surface and in the shallow crust. It is an iron oxide with a chemical composition of Fe 2 O 3.It is a common rock-forming mineral found in sedimentary, metamorphic, and igneous rocks at locations throughout the world.. Feb 29, 2020· Magnetic Ballast: Magnetic ballast is actually an inductive coil. It actually looks like a transformer, a copper wire wound over a core material. Inductors are generally used to oppose a change in current passing through them. Working of Magnetic Ballast: In order for the tube light to work, the electrodes must be at a high temperature.

Ballast Water Filter Ballast water filter for ballast water treatment. Without ballast water, modern freight shipping is inconceivable. Each year, between ten and twelve billion tons of ballast water are transported by ocean going vessels. However, it presents an enormous environmental problem all over the world. Lamp ballasts are devices that control the flow of electricity to fluorescent and HID lamps. Ballasts contain a capacitor, and a transformer.
